When was THE CHOTA ESTATES COMPANY LIMITED founded?
THE CHOTA ESTATES COMPANY LIMITED was officially incorporated on 30 December 1983 and is registered under company number 01781430. Incorporation establishes the company as a legal entity registered at Companies House, allowing it to trade, enter contracts, and operate under UK company law.

What does THE CHOTA ESTATES COMPANY LIMITED do?
THE CHOTA ESTATES COMPANY LIMITED operates in the following sector: 41100 - Development of building projects. This provides insight into the company's primary business activity and industry focus.

Does THE CHOTA ESTATES COMPANY LIMITED have any charges or mortgages?
THE CHOTA ESTATES COMPANY LIMITED has 6 registered charges, of which 0 are outstanding, 6 satisfied, and 0 part satisfied. Charges are typically registered when a company uses its assets as security for borrowing.
